What companies run services between Moscow, Russia and Lecce, Italy?

Air Serbia, ITA Airways, and four other airlines fly from Sheremetyevo International Airport (SVO) to Brindisi Airport (BDS) 6 times a week.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Moscow Novoyasnevskaya to Lecce via Minsk Central Bus Station, Munich Central Bus Station, Munich, and Rocca Imperiale in around 2d 8h.
